Smith Named Walter Camp Defensive Player Of The Week

Missouri's Aldon Smith, a sophomore defensive end, was named the Walter Camp Football Foundation National Defensive Player of the Week.

Smith earns the honor after recording a team-high 10 tackles in Mizzou's 23-13 win over Illinois on Saturday, Sept. 4. Smith also had two sacks and one quarterback hurry as the Tigers held Illinois scoreless in the second half.

In its seventh year, the Walter Camp Football Foundation will honor one offensive and one defensive player as its national Bowl subdivision player of the week during the regular season. Recipients are selected by a panel of nation media members and administered by the Walter Camp Football Foundation.
